Apprenticeship Program
An apprenticeship allows you to earn money while you learn on the job. In addition to on-the-job training, each year you attend 6-10 weeks of technical training. Once you have completed all your schooling and reached the required hours, you are eligible to write your Red Seal Exam. Once you pass, you will receive your Journeyperson Card!
We have grown over 20 Apprentices into a Journeyperson role at Dynamo.

While the process may vary based on different roles, here are some of the ways we assess our candidates in the hiring process:
Preliminary Telephone Interviews
This is typically our first step with you as a candidate. We will have a short 15–20-minute phone call to discuss your past work and schooling experience, some key skills and job requirements before taking some time to answer any questions you may have.
If you have not heard from us within two weeks of your interview, it is safe to assume we have moved on with another candidate.
Formal Interviews
Formal Interviews consist of sitting down with Human Resources and the Hiring Manager and going a little more in-depth about your experience. This interview is often at least an hour long and will be a combination of experience, skill, and behavioural style questions.
We will contact you regardless of how this interview goes.
Skill Assessments
To better understand the skills you bring to the table, we often do skills assessments. This varies based on the role for which you have applied. Some skill assessment examples include: formatting documents, and reading electrical drawings.
Prevue Assessments
This 35-minute assessment helps us get to see the full picture of you. We use Prevue’s reliable scientific model to ensure that your traits, interests, and skills complement the role for which you have applied.
